
UP hills rocked again, 1 killed
CHAMOLI: A fresh tremor rocked Garhwal region today killing one person and injuring several others in Chamoli district . A 55-year-old man was killed in Pipakoti village when his house caved in under the impact of the earthquake measuring 4.8 on the Richter Scale which struck at 0210 hours, officials said. Authorities apprehend more damage to life and property in remote areas.
Agni test
BALASORE: India8217;s new long range intermediate ballistic missile Agni-II is expected to be test fired from the IC-4 of the Inner Wheeler Island on the Orissa coast either on April seven or eight. This is the first time that the Agni-II missile, with a range of over 1800 km, would be test fired from the island. Earlier, Agni had been test fired thrice from the Interim Test Range ITR at Chandipur-on-Sea.
Big Bull charged
MUMBAI: In a fresh case concerning the multi-crore securities scam, CBI has filed a chargesheet against Big Bull Harshad Mehta and four othersaccusing them of hatching a conspiracy to cause wrongful loss of Rs 16.25 crore to state Bank of India Capital Markets.
